Nature enthusiasts will find exceptional opportunities for excursions with children in Jaén, particularly in its remarkable national and natural parks. Sierra de Cazorla, Segura y Las Villas Natural Park stands out as a premier destination for family outdoor adventures. This expansive protected area offers numerous hiking trails suitable for children, featuring well-marked paths and stunning biodiversity. Families can observe native wildlife, including deer, wild boars, and numerous bird species, transforming each walk into an exciting educational experience. The park provides guided tours specifically designed for children, helping them understand ecological systems and local environmental conservation. Interactive visitor centers offer engaging exhibits that make learning about nature fun and accessible. Additionally, the park features picnic areas and safe observation points, ensuring comfortable and secure family outings. Water-based activities like gentle river walks and supervised swimming areas provide refreshing alternatives to traditional hiking. Professional guides can accompany families, offering expert insights into the region's unique ecosystem and geological formations. Beyond natural landscapes, Jaén offers remarkable cultural and historical excursions perfect for children. The province's rich historical heritage provides immersive learning experiences that go beyond traditional classroom education. Úbeda and Baeza, both UNESCO World Heritage Sites, offer architectural tours that captivate young minds with Renaissance-era buildings and fascinating historical narratives. Interactive museums like the Iberian Museum in Jaén city provide hands-on exhibits where children can touch artifacts and participate in archaeological workshops. Castle tours, such as those in Santa Catalina Castle, allow children to explore medieval structures and imagine historical narratives. Local olive oil museums offer unique experiences, teaching children about the region's primary agricultural product through engaging, sensory-based exhibits. Guided tours often include storytelling sessions that make historical information accessible and entertaining for younger audiences.
